Output 658bbe05e5c7f87d4ac2906ffff854f5633002a10e4a94bbbb4793b7664292ed:2

value
269381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94b6e25cf2678b90d77bc075b135d40cc6e14fd OP_EQUAL
address
3H8AUx3CnQVG3P4Chv3azuJa1Kv86QQSvH
transaction
658bbe05e5c7f87d4ac2906ffff854f5633002a10e4a94bbbb4793b7664292ed
confirmations
376124
spent
true